Understanding the Challenges of Ecommerce Search
In the dynamic realm of ecommerce, where digital storefronts compete for consumer attention, an efficient and intelligent search functionality is more than a luxury—it’s a competitive advantage. Ecommerce search engines face unique challenges amidst the vast sea of products, customer preferences, and ever-evolving trends. The primary hurdle lies in balancing accuracy with relevance, ensuring that when a customer types in a query, they not only find their exact product but also related items that align with their intent.
Moreover, managing vast product catalogs, integrating diverse data sources, and personalizing search results based on user behavior are intricate tasks. The Role of Advanced Algorithms in Intelligent Search
In the realm of ecommerce, intelligent search is transforming how customers navigate vast product catalogs. The backbone of this evolution are advanced algorithms that go beyond traditional keyword matching. These sophisticated tools employ machine learning and natural language processing to understand customer intent, context, and even sentiment. By analyzing user behavior patterns, search history, and preferences, they deliver highly personalized results, ensuring that shoppers find precisely what they’re looking for—and often more than they expected.
Ecommerce search engines powered by these algorithms can interpret complex queries, recognize synonyms, and account for spelling mistakes or variations in product names. This not only enhances user experience but also drives conversions by presenting relevant products at every step of the customer journey. As a result, businesses are able to optimize their product listings, improve inventory management, and create a more engaging shopping environment that fosters loyalty and repeat visits.
Enhancing User Experience with Contextual Search
In the realm of ecommerce, a user’s experience with the search function can make or break their overall satisfaction. Contextual search is a game-changer that revolutionizes how customers interact with online stores. By understanding the customer’s intent and context, intelligent search engines can provide relevant and accurate results, ensuring users find what they’re looking for swiftly. This enhances navigation, reduces frustration, and encourages repeat visits.
Contextual search goes beyond basic keyword matching. It leverages advanced algorithms to interpret user queries, factoring in past behavior, product preferences, and even location. For instance, a customer searching for “running shoes” while viewing fitness gear may receive personalized results based on their previous purchases or browsing history. This level of personalization not only improves the user experience but also increases conversion rates by presenting users with products that align with their interests and needs.
Measuring Success: Key Performance Indicators for Ecommerce Search Engines
Measuring success is paramount in the world of ecommerce search engines, as it allows for continuous optimization and improvement.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) play a crucial role in gauging the effectiveness of search functionality. One of the primary KPIs is user satisfaction, which can be evaluated through metrics like click-through rates (CTR), average session duration, and bounce rate. A high CTR indicates that relevant products are being presented to users, while extended session durations suggest engaging results.
Additionally, conversion rate optimization is vital. By tracking the percentage of visitors who complete a purchase after interacting with search results, ecommerce platforms can assess the overall performance of their search engines. Other relevant KPIs include product click-through rates, which measure user interest in specific products, and search query accuracy, ensuring that search engine algorithms deliver precise results aligned with user intent.
